什么是虚拟化技术
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
什么是虚拟化技术
虚拟化技术的崛起与应用
虚拟化技术是当今信息技术领域中的一项重要技术,它不仅在企业
领域广泛应用,而且在云计算、网络安全、数据中心管理等多个领域
也发挥着关键作用。
本文将深入探讨什么是虚拟化技术以及它的应用,以帮助读者更好地理解这一重要概念。
虚拟化技术是一种通过软件或硬件实现的技术,它允许将物理资源(如服务器、存储和网络)划分为多个虚拟资源的过程。
这些虚拟资
源可以独立运行,就像它们是物理资源一样。
虚拟化的主要目标是提
高资源利用率、降低成本、提高灵活性和可扩展性。
虚拟化技术的关键概念包括:
1. **虚拟机(VM):** 虚拟机是虚拟化的基本单位,它是一个独
立的操作系统实例,可以在物理服务器上运行。
每个虚拟机都有自己
的资源分配,包括处理器、内存、存储和网络。
2. **宿主机:** 宿主机是运行虚拟机的物理服务器。
它负责虚拟机的创建、管理和资源分配。
3. **Hypervisor:** Hypervisor是虚拟化软件或硬件,它允许多个
虚拟机共享同一台物理服务器。
有两种主要类型的Hypervisor:Type 1(裸机Hypervisor)直接运行在物理硬件上,而Type 2(主机模式Hypervisor)运行在操作系统之上。
虚拟化技术的应用:
1. **服务器虚拟化:** 服务器虚拟化是虚拟化技术的最常见应用之一。
它允许多个虚拟服务器在同一台物理服务器上运行,从而降低硬件成本,提高资源利用率,并简化管理。
知名的虚拟化平台包括VMware vSphere、Microsoft Hyper-V和KVM。
2. **桌面虚拟化:** 桌面虚拟化允许将多个虚拟桌面部署在单个服务器或云环境中。
这对于大型组织来说是一种管理桌面环境的有效方式,可以提高数据安全性,降低维护成本。
3. **存储虚拟化:** 存储虚拟化将多个存储设备抽象为一个单一的虚拟存储池,提供了更好的数据管理和可扩展性。
这有助于简化存储管理,并提高数据可用性。
4. **网络虚拟化:** 网络虚拟化允许创建虚拟网络,使多个逻辑网络可以在同一物理网络基础设施上运行。
这有助于提高网络资源的利用率,加强网络安全性,以及简化网络配置和管理。
5. **云计算:** 虚拟化技术是云计算的关键组成部分。
云服务提供商使用虚拟化来在共享基础设施上提供弹性和可伸缩的计算资源。
用户可以根据需要创建和销毁虚拟机,以满足其计算需求。
6. **容器虚拟化:** 虚拟化技术还包括容器虚拟化,如Docker和Kubernetes。
容器是轻量级的虚拟化实例,用于封装应用程序及其依赖项,以便跨不同环境中进行部署和管理。
总结:
虚拟化技术是当今信息技术领域中的一项关键技术,它在多个领域中有广泛的应用。
通过允许资源的更好利用和更灵活的管理,虚拟化技术已经改变了企业和云计算的方式,提高了效率,降低了成本。
随着技术的不断发展,虚拟化技术将继续在未来发挥重要作用,推动着信息技术的进步。